It is just simply time to grow up and understand that if free Americans want to plop down $100 on their favorite team, we should be allowed to do so. Yes, we understand the fears of the NFL and other professional leagues face with gambling, but newsflash, people are betting anyway.

Did you know one of the NFL founding owners, Tim Mara, was a bookmaker?

Let’s also factor in that the current U.S. economy is in the tank, yet 99% of all sports betting is unregulated and untaxed. Has making betting illegal stopped the activity? No it has not. Sports betting  should be made legal and taxed to generate some much needed revenue that would help re-build our roads, infrastructure, and improve schools.
